#453f7f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#453f7f is composed of 27.1% red, 24.7%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.7%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.7% and a lightness of 37.3%. #453f7f color hex could be obtained by blending #8a7efe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#453f7f color description : Dark moderate blue.
#453f7f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#453f7f has RGB values of R:69, G:63,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4538239.
